Week 52. Hurrah ... I've reached my one year theremin-anniversary. One full year of learning to play the theremin; I wonder how many hours of practice I've done during the last 12 months.

I wanted something special to celebrate the occasion, so I chose something I felt would be a real challenge (for me, at least). The piano arrangement for this piece is quite fast ... and there are sooooo many notes to learn! (More than twice the amount of notes played in Saint-Saens' "The Swan" but in 30 seconds less time!!!) On the plus side, there aren't too many big jumps. Anyway ... I REALLY enjoyed learning this. I tried out different pre-set voices and ranges on the E-Pro, and finally decided to use the second preset (the one that sounds like Clangers) and the highest range-setting, neither of which I've used before; the result is rather like a canary singing opera!

I've tried various settings on my amp when playing my Etherwave Standard through it, but, although I've sometimes found a less string-like tone than the E-Standard usually plays, it's never as mellow and flute-like as this ''whistle'' preset on the Etherwave-Pro. Also, the E-Pro has 3 range settings; this is the highest - a good octave higher than anything you can play on the E-Standard.

    Each make of theremin seems to have its own individual sound!
